1. 什么是索引?
2. 为什么需要创建索引?
3. MySQL中如何创建索引?
4. 创建索引需要注意哪些问题?
详细回答如下:
1. 什么是索引?
索引是一种数据结构,用于加速数据库中数据的查找。在数据库中,索引类似于书的目录,可以帮助大家快速定位到数据所在的位置。
2. 为什么需要创建索引?
在数据库中,当大家需要查询大量数据时,如果没有索引,数据库需要逐个扫描数据,查询效率非常低下。而创建索引可以大大提高数据库查询效率,从而加快查询速度。
3. MySQL中如何创建索引?
yydex的索引:
“`yydexn1n2);
n1n2为需要创建索引的列名。
yydex的索引:
“`y_table (n1 INT,n2 VARCHAR(50),ydexn1n2)
4. 创建索引需要注意哪些问题?
尽管创建索引可以提高数据库查询效率,但过多的索引也会降低数据库的性能。因此,在创建索引时需要注意以下几点:
– 不要为所有列都创建索引,只为经常用于查询的列创建索引。
– 不要为数据量过小的表创建索引,因为这样会增加索引的维护成本,反而会降低查询效率。
– 对于经常执行的查询,可以创建覆盖索引。覆盖索引是一种特殊的索引,它包含所有查询所需的数据,从而避免了数据库的额外查找操作。ydex的索引:
“`yydexn1 = 1;
总之,创建索引需要根据具体情况进行选择,不能盲目地创建索引。只有在正确使用索引的情况下,才能真正提高数据库查询效率。
如果觉得《MySQL创建索引(提高数据库查询效率的方法) mysql 刷新用户名》对你有帮助,请点赞、收藏,并留下你的观点哦!